How Many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ners Work in California?
In 2018, there were 57,770 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ners working in the state.
There were 56,640 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ners employed in this state in 2017.
That’s growth of 1,130 jobs between 2017 and 2018.

The typical state has 4,460 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ners working in it, which means California has more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ners than average.

Job Projections for California
Jobs for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ners in this state are growing at a rate of 12.7% which is faster than the nationwide estimated projection of 10.7%.

California Annual Job Openings
The BLS estimates 8,420 annual job openings, and a total of 59,400 jobs for California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ners in 2026.
Nationwide, the prediction is 57,800 annual jobs and 408,700 total jobs in 2026.
What do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ners Make in California?
In 2018 wages for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ners ranged from $22,600 to $38,780 with $25,960 being the median annual salary.
Broken down to an hourly rate, workers in this field made anywhere from $10.87 to $18.65. The median hourly rate was $12.48.
In 2017 the median pay for this field was $11.75 an hour.
The hourly rate grew by $0.73.
The median salary in California is higher than the nationwide median salary.

Top California Metros for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ners
The table below shows some of the metros in this state with the most Vehicle and Equipment Cleaners.
Metro | Number Employed | Annual Median Salary |
---|---|---|
Los Angeles-Long Beach-Anaheim, CA | 21,850 | $25,840 |
San Francisco-Oakland-Hayward, CA | 6,500 | $30,120 |
Riverside-San Bernardino-Ontario, CA | 6,160 | $24,190 |
San Diego-Carlsbad, CA | 4,290 | $25,160 |
Sacramento–Roseville–Arden-Arcade, CA | 3,120 | $25,230 |
San Jose-Sunnyvale-Santa Clara, CA | 2,610 | $29,570 |
Fresno, CA | 1,540 | $25,710 |
Oxnard-Thousand Oaks-Ventura, CA | 1,430 | $24,900 |
Stockton-Lodi, CA | 1,160 | $24,920 |
Bakersfield, CA | 1,150 | $28,750 |
Santa Rosa, CA | 1,060 | $28,990 |
Modesto, CA | 890 | $25,170 |
Vallejo-Fairfield, CA | 650 | $25,140 |
Santa Maria-Santa Barbara, CA | 560 | $25,310 |
Santa Cruz-Watsonville, CA | 540 | $28,220 |
Visalia-Porterville, CA | 540 | $24,820 |
Salinas, CA | 510 | $24,240 |
Merced, CA | 410 | $24,990 |
San Luis Obispo-Paso Robles-Arroyo Grande, CA | 330 | $25,800 |
Redding, CA | 220 | $24,660 |
Chico, CA | 190 | $25,100 |
El Centro, CA | 190 | $25,740 |
Yuba City, CA | 170 | $24,070 |
Napa, CA | 140 | $27,750 |
Hanford-Corcoran, CA | 100 | $27,590 |
Madera, CA | 40 | $24,010 |
